Title:
METHOD AND APPARATUS FOR OPTICAL MOLDING

Abstract:

To provide a small-sized optical molding apparatus at low cost.

An exposure head 23 is formed by preparing a number of blue color LED, connecting an optical fiber to each of them, and disposing a GRIN lens at the distal end of these optical fibers. The exposure head 23 can form images with respect to the image at the distal end face of each optical fiber on the exposure range 24 of photosetting resin as ant optical spot. Although the diameter of the optical spot 55 is 0.5 mm for example, the size of pixels 71 within the exposure region 24 is by far small, e.g. 62.5 μm. Thus, a number of optical fibers on the exposure head 23 are arranged in a matrix displaced in staggered relation in order for each optical spots 55 to be arranged at a pitch of 62.5 μm of the pixel 71 in the major scanning direction (Y axis). While scanning the exposure range 24 with the exposure head 23 in the ancillary scanning (X axis) direction, a multiple exposure is conducted by making all optical spots 'ON' capable of lightening the pixels relative to individual pixels 71 to be exposed within the exposure region 24.
